A clickwrap agreement, also known as a click through, shrink-wrap, or sign-in-wrap, is an online agreement in which the user signifies his or her acceptance by clicking a button or checking a box that states I agree. The purpose of a clickwrap agreement is to digitally capture acceptance of a contract.
Related Content. Also known as a clickthrough agreement and clickwrap license. A form of agreement used for software licensing, websites, and other electronic media. It requires the user to agree to terms and conditions before using a website or completing an installation or online purchase process.

Click wrap contracts and shrink wrap contracts are unilateral and are presented as a fixed contracts whereas browse wrap contracts are quite different because they do not force the consumer to accept the contract rather the acceptance is assumed while using the website.
Is clickwrap legally enforceable? Yes, clickwrap agreements (provided they are designed, presented, and tracked in compliance with best practices) are just as enforceable as both traditional wet ink signatures and electronic signatures in the US.
As with binding contracts, a failure to read a clickwrap provision for instance, scrolling through the terms and conditions and clicking the I agree button at the bottom will not excuse compliance or enforceability (except for fraud).
The short answer is yes. Courts across the United States have confirmed that clicking on a checkbox is akin to a signature on a written contract. Essentially, by clicking I agree or I accept, the consumer provides the mutual assent required to form a legally binding agreement.
For us, this essentially means that clickwrap agreements will not be unenforceable simply because they happen to be digital. In other words, this is saying that clickwrap agreements are e-contracts and hence will be enforceable in a court of law. This is only if all the conditions of a valid contract are fulfilled.
